Comprehending Glass Damage

Before delving into repair alternatives, it's vital to acknowledge the typical types of glass damage. Understanding these can help property owners identify the severity of the damage and the necessary repair actions.

Type of DamageDescriptionRepair Options
Chips and CracksSmall problems that can take place due to effect or temperature modifications.Repair with resin or replace the entire pane if extreme.
Broken PanesTotal shattering or big fractures that jeopardize integrity.Replacement of the glass pane.
ScratchesSurface-level scratches generally triggered by cleansing or contact with difficult objects.Polishing or glass repair kits for small scratches.
Failed SealsWater or condensation structure in between double-glazed windows, indicating a stopped working seal.Replacement of the insulated window unit.

When to Repair vs. Replace

Identifying whether to repair or change glass can be a challenging decision. Here are several elements to consider:

  1. Severity of Damage: Minor chips might be repairable, while extensive cracks or shattered glass usually demand a complete replacement.
  2. Location: Glass that is vital for security or insulation (e.g., windows) need to be changed if damaged to preserve home security and effectiveness.
  3. Expense: Sometimes, the expense of fixing damaged glass can approach or exceed that of a new installation. Property owners must examine and compare costs.
  4. Aesthetic Value: If the glass is decorative (like stained glass or a custom mirror), repairing might be the favored choice to preserve the original appearance.
  5. Time Constraints: Repairs can often be completed faster than replacements, specifically for small damage.

Cost of Residential Glass Repair

The cost of glass repair can differ substantially depending on numerous elements, consisting of the kind of damage, size of the glass, and whether you choose a professional service or do it yourself. Here's a general breakdown of costs connected with various kinds of glass repairs:

Repair TypeEstimated CostNotes
Chip Repair₤ 50 - ₤ 100Quick and often covered by insurance coverage
Split Repair₤ 100 - ₤ 300Cost increases with crack length
Pane Replacement₤ 200 - ₤ 600Depend upon size, type, and installation requirements
Mirror Repair₤ 100 - ₤ 250Specialty mirrors might cost more
Shower Door Replacement₤ 300 - ₤ 1,000Custom tasks might surpass this range

Frequently Asked Question About Residential Glass Repair

1. How do I understand if my glass is repairable?

  • If the damage is minor, such as a small chip or crack, it is frequently repairable. Nevertheless, bigger fractures or shattered glass generally require replacement.

2. Can I repair glass myself?

  • Yes, there are DIY kits readily available for minor repairs, however it's advisable to seek professional assistance for considerable damage.

3. How long does a glass repair take?

  • An easy chip repair can take less than an hour, while a full pane replacement might require a number of hours to a day, depending upon the complexity.

4. Is glass repair covered by insurance coverage?

  • Lots of homeowners' insurance coverage cover glass damage, however it's important to examine your specific policy for protection details.
